1、Definition of Response Time
The term "response time" can be defined as the elapsed time between the initiation of a request and the completion of the response. In simpler terms, it is the time it takes for a system or service to acknowledge and fulfill a user's request. Response time is often measured in milliseconds, microseconds, or seconds, depending on the context.

2、Importance of Response Time
a. User Experience
One of the primary reasons why response time is crucial is its impact on user experience. In today's highly competitive market, businesses are constantly striving to provide a seamless and enjoyable experience to their customers. A slow response time can lead to frustration, dissatisfaction, and ultimately, a loss of business.
b. Efficiency
Efficiency is another critical aspect influenced by response time. A system or service that responds quickly can handle more requests in a given time frame, leading to increased productivity and reduced costs. On the other hand, a slow response time can cause bottlenecks, delays, and increased resource consumption.
c. Performance Optimization
Understanding response time helps businesses identify and address performance bottlenecks. By analyzing the factors that contribute to slow response times, organizations can optimize their systems and services, resulting in improved performance and reliability.
3、Measuring Response Time
There are several methods to measure response time, depending on the context:
a. Benchmarking

Benchmarking involves comparing the response time of a system or service to industry standards or competitors. This helps organizations identify areas for improvement and ensure they are meeting or exceeding expectations.
b. Real User Monitoring (RUM)
Real User Monitoring is a technique that tracks the performance of a system or service based on actual user interactions. This method provides valuable insights into the user experience and helps identify performance issues.
c. Synthetic Monitoring
Synthetic monitoring involves simulating user requests and measuring the response time. This method is useful for identifying potential performance issues before they impact real users.
d. Load Testing
Load testing involves subjecting a system or service to high traffic loads to measure its performance under stress. This helps organizations ensure that their systems can handle peak usage without experiencing slow response times.
4、Optimizing Response Time
a. Code Optimization
Optimizing the code of a system or service can significantly reduce response times. This involves identifying and fixing inefficient algorithms, reducing database queries, and minimizing resource consumption.

b. Infrastructure Scaling
Scaling the infrastructure of a system or service can help improve response times, especially during peak usage periods. This may involve adding more servers, upgrading hardware, or implementing cloud-based solutions.
c. Caching
Implementing caching mechanisms can reduce response times by storing frequently accessed data in memory. This allows the system to quickly retrieve data without the need for processing-intensive operations.
d. Load Balancing
Load balancing distributes incoming traffic across multiple servers, ensuring that no single server is overwhelmed. This helps improve response times and ensures high availability.
